- What is H&R Block's other — total revenues?
- H&R Block (HRB) reported other — total revenues of $15M in Q1 2026.
- How has H&R Block's other — total revenues changed year-over-year?
- H&R Block's other — total revenues increased by 2.9% year-over-year, from $14.58M to $15M.
- What is the long-term trend for H&R Block's other — total revenues?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), H&R Block's other — total revenues has grown at a 11.9%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$37.16M to $58.32M.
- What does other — total revenues mean?
- This metric represents the total revenue generated by business activities that fall outside of the company's primary tax preparation and digital tax software segments. It captures income from ancillary services, secondary product lines, or non-core business operations that contribute to the overall corporate revenue stream. Monitoring this figure helps investors assess the diversification of the company's revenue base and the growth potential of its emerging or supplementary service offerings.
